Address

1QJadVXyuQzEFyK3EJjgRDthjSboyty39c
Confirmed tx count
65
Confirmed received
33 outputs (0.17150409 BTC)
Confirmed spent
33 outputs (0.17150409 BTC)
Confirmed unspent
No outputs

25 of 65 Transactions